Reciprocating impact hammer
12215480 · 2025-02-04 · ·

An impact hammer for breaking a working surface, the hammer including a drive mechanism and a housing with an inner containment surface and a reciprocating hammer weight. A reciprocation cycle of the hammer weight includes an upstroke and a down-stroke, the hammer weight respectively moving upwards and downwards. On the down-stroke the hammer weight impacts a striker pin with a driven end and a working surface impact end. A vacuum chamber in the housing is formed by the containment surface, upper vacuum sealing coupled to the hammer weight and lower vacuum sealing. The hammer weight is driven toward the striker pin by the pressure differential between atmosphere and the vacuum chamber formed on the upstroke. A down-stroke vent permits fluid egress from the vacuum chamber on the down-stroke.

ATTACHMENT FOR AN EXCAVATOR
20250059722 · 2025-02-20 ·

An attachment for coupling to a quick coupler on a dipper arm of an excavator includes a rotor having a plurality of ground engaging teeth mounted thereon, and a motor for rotatably driving the rotor. The rotor may be rotatably mounted between a pair of side plates to extend substantially parallel to the ground, in use, with a cover plate extending between the side plates to extend over at least an upper portion of the rotor. Optionally, a coupling on the cover plate is adapted to engage a quick coupler provided on a distal end of the dipper arm of the excavator.

Demolition hammer with reversible housing and interchangeable wear plate arrangement

A demolition hammer is provided that includes a housing that is reversible and a plurality of interchangeable wear plates. The demolition hammer may include a housing a housing having a first wall and a second wall opposite the first wall, and a power cell disposed within the housing, the power cell having a front face, wherein the housing is reversible such that the housing can be used with the power cell in a first orientation in which the front face faces the first wall and a second orientation in which the front face faces the second wall.

Excavator Bucket With an Internally Deployable Breaker
20170037596 · 2017-02-09 ·

An excavating machine, representatively a skid steer, has a pair of loader arms to which an excavating bucket is mounted. A hydraulic breaker assembly is protectively mounted inside the bucket and movable to extend outward therefrom. The bucket may be operated independently of the breaker assembly for digging operations. The breaker assembly may be positioned independently of the bucket and the breaker actuated for removing refusal material. The bucket and the breaker may then be cooperatively operated to perform removal operations. The same excavating machine can be used for digging and breaking operations without the need for a second excavating machine or device dedicated to breaking the refusal material.

Excavator Shearing Implement
20170022684 · 2017-01-26 ·

A shearing implement for use with an excavator is disclosed. The shearing implement comprises a thumb having a grasping side and a cutting side and being pivotably attachable to the boom. A shearing blade member is pivotably attached to the cutting side of the thumb. A linear actuator has a first end attached to the shearing blade member and a second end attachable to the boom or the thumb so that extension and retraction of the linear actuator causes the shearing blade member to rotate relative to the thumb.

Impact controller for primary rock breakage
12286883 · 2025-04-29 ·

A mining apparatus for primary breakage having a drop hammer with a drop weight that may fall from a first position where the drop weight is suspended within an upper end of the drop hammer and a second position where the drop weight extends from a lower end of the drop hammer. The mining apparatus has a shock absorber assembly coupled to the lower end of the drop hammer with a first passageway through which the drop weight may pass. The mining apparatus also has a rebound cage coupled to the shock absorber assembly and having a series of guides positioned therein and arranged about a second passageway that is in alignment with the first passageway. The rebound cage controls the drop weight when it falls into the second position, strikes the ground, and rebounds.

Lift attachment apparatus
12404152 · 2025-09-02 ·

The present disclosure is a lift attachment apparatus for construction and farm equipment, including a loader. In an embodiment of the disclosure, lift apparatus may include a frame including an attachment device configured to attach to a tilting plane of a loader having a forward facing loader arm, a pair of wheels connected to the frame, a first wheel of the pair of wheels located on a first side of the frame and a second wheel of the pair of wheels located on a second side of the frame. The lift attachment apparatus may further include a boom or forks connected directly or indirectly to the frame.

SUBMERSIBLE UNDERWATER DREDGE WITH INTEGRATED METAL DETECTOR
20250314039 · 2025-10-09 ·

Disclosed herein is a hand-held underwater dredge integrated with a metal detector, designed for locating and retrieving metallic objects from aquatic environments. Equipped with a suction-generating electric pump and powered by an onboard battery to enable operation while fully submerged, the dredge features a pipe system leading to a catch can that captures metal items while expelling the water drawn into the pipe system by the generated suction. In operation, users scan a riverbed, seabed, or lakebed using the metal detector. Once a metal item is detected, the user places the suction end of the pipe system over the metal item and activates the electric pump to start the suction, leading to capture of the metal item in the catch can for retrieval. This streamlines the process of underwater treasure hunting, combining detection and collection into a single user-operated system.
